Eileen Iona Fernal Whyte Dies at 91

Eileen Iona Fernal Whyte

Eileen Iona Fernal Whyte of Estate Grove Place died on Jan. 30. She was 91 years old.

She was preceded in death by her daughter, Beryl Samuel; brother, Clement Whyte; sister, Irose Gordon; and grandchildren: Daudi “Bwani” Bakar Tishawn Samuel and Jinika Nisbitt.

A viewing will take place at 10 a.m. followed by a funeral service at 11 a.m., Wednesday, Feb. 23, at St. Paul’s Anglican Church. Interment will follow at Kingshill Cemetery.

Due to the COVID-19 pandemic, all attendees must wear a mask and adhere to social distancing guidelines.
